Ticket: Staging env misconfigured for Siftgate bloom filter

The bloom layer in front of the Pellet KV store is rejecting all lookups in staging because the env file was copied from the dev template without credentials. False-positive tuning values are fine; only the auth line is missing. To unblock the weekly demo, the Pellet admission secret must be set on the following line.

env line for yaguf-fajop: LEDGER_TOKEN13=fb08984397349

The Sievegate platform loads data-validator plugins at startup from the signed plugin registry. Each plugin declares its schema scope; anything touching PII fields requires a manifest flag and review sign-off. To audit: list loaded plugins via the admin endpoint, diff against the registry manifest, and confirm signatures match the current trust root. Unsigned or scope-escalated plugins must be quarantined immediately and the loader restarted. The admin endpoint requires the reviewer service account. Authenticate using the key that follows.

gateway credential: kto23_LX9A4ys6i4nzHtpOLNLodKK

Handover: Brimvolt OTA channel

Taking over firmware distribution for the Brimvolt device line. Channel layout: stable, beta, canary. Manifests are signed at build; devices verify signature and monotonic version before flashing. Rollbacks blocked unless the recovery flag is set server-side. Canary is capped at 2% of fleet; promotion to stable needs two sign-offs. Known issue: beta devices retry aggressively on manifest fetch failure — rate limiter in front handles it. Nothing else pending. The channel service runs with the settings below.

deployment values, fafog-fawip:
[jorox]
team = fendor
access_code = ac_bb00ea
host = jorox.qorveltech.internal
port = 9200
owner = istdor.aldeth
peer = julvan.orvexlabs.internal

**Q: Bike cage and parking gates — how do I get in?**

Bike cage is behind Block C at Harlow Quay. Gates open 06:00–22:00. New starters: register your vehicle with reception first, or the gate won't lift. No overnight parking. Helmets stay with your bike, not in lockers. Use the entry code printed below.

staff pass of kawip-hawef = bdg-QLP-2